Hello Autumn (posted on November 2, 2016)


Autumn has arrived and with it all the things that make it one of my favorite seasons. 

The leaves have turned brilliant hues of red, orange and gold and are now falling from the trees creating a colorful carpet. The sun is shining, the air is crisp and slightly chilled. 
The kitchen is scented with apples and cinnamon. There are several bags of apples waiting to be made into delicious treats. I've made apple pie, apple dumplings and apple squares. Soon I'll be making homemade apple sauce. 
This weekend hubby will be raking leaves while our dog runs happily thru the freshly raked piles. There will be homemade soup simmering on the stove while desert is baking in the oven. It will be something with apples of course! 
Soon I'll be thinking of the holidays, but for now I just want to enjoy this most lovely of seasons.
